The diurnal variation in the expansive pressure exerted by the vapor is illustrated by diagram IX., showing the results of observations made at Vienna. The annual varia- tion in vapor tension is given for the same station in the following diagram, No. X. By the relative humidity is meant the absolute hu- midity expressed as a fraction of the total quantity of moisture that the air would contain if perfectly satura- DIAGRAM ix.-Diumai Change of Vapor Pressure. ted . at %* observed temperature. As to its diurnal variation, the relative humidity is least in the hottest portion of the afternoon, and greatest shortly before sunrise, as shown in diagram XI. ; similarly, as to its annual variation, it is least in the summer months and greatest in the winter, as shown by comparing the curves for January and July in the same diagram, or more fully by the an- nual curve (E.
